When a child has learned the meaning of the spoken word, he/she can learn the meaning of the written word.  The key is in the meaning, very hard to define, but summarized in the common statement of “I know what it is.” When educators teach a child a new spoken word, they are connecting meaning to the sound.  In the same way when you teach a new written word, you are connecting meaning to the word.  Reading should be easier because after the spoken word meaning is gone, the print remains. The Kusoma app can be used for basic vocabulary and I expect a sentence app to be available soon. In formal school (PP1 and 2), the child learns the use of LLT. After a lesson of 10 words, those 10 words have many uses which a child can use to read and understand sentences. Furthermore, they can learn to write sentences of their own.
